#648521 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#648521 is composed of 39.2% red, 52.2% green and 12.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 75.2% yellow and 47.8% black. It has a hue angle of 79.8 degrees, a saturation of 60.2% and a lightness of 32.5%. #648521 color hex could be obtained by blending #c8ff42 with #000b00.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

#648521 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#648521 has RGB values of R:100, G:133, B:33 and CMYK values of C:0.25, M:0, Y:0.75,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 6587681.
